如何快速掌握vba编程基础知识?
想要在教育培训行业获得更多的竞争优势?想要提升自己的工作效率,实现更高的职业发展?那么,掌握vba编程基础知识将是您不可或缺的技能。但是,什么是vba编程?为什么要学习它?学习vba编程前需要具备哪些基础知识?如何快速入门vba编程?本文将为您一一解答,并推荐最有效的学习方法和资源。同时,还会介绍vba编程常用语法和函数,并分享实用案例,帮助您运用vba编程提高工作效率。让我们一起来探索这个充满挑战和机遇的领域吧!
什么是vba编程?为什么要学习它?
1. 什么是vba编程?
VBA(Visual Basic for Applications)是一种基于微软的Visual Basic语言的宏语言,它可以在Office软件中进行编程,如Excel、Word、PowerPoint等。通过使用VBA编程,用户可以自定义功能和操作,实现自动化处理和数据分析,提高工作效率。
2. 为什么要学习vba编程?
2.1 提高工作效率
随着科技的发展,办公软件已经成为我们日常工作中必不可少的工具。而学习vba编程可以帮助我们更加高效地使用这些软件。通过编写自定义的宏代码,可以实现一键批量处理数据、自动生成报表等功能,大大节省了时间和精力。
2.2 拓展职业发展空间
随着信息技术的不断进步,计算机技术已经成为各行业必备的技能之一。而掌握vba编程能力可以让你在职场上多一项强有力的竞争优势。无论是在数据分析、财务管理还是项目管理等领域,都会有大量需要用到vba编程技术的岗位。
2.3 实现个人创造力
学习vba编程也可以让我们更加发挥个人创造力。通过自定义宏代码,可以实现各种复杂的功能和操作,让我们的工作更加个性化。此外,vba编程也是一种很好的学习方式,可以培养我们的逻辑思维能力和解决问题的能力。
3. 如何快速掌握vba编程基础知识?
3.1 学习基础知识
要想快速掌握vba编程,首先需要学习其基础知识。可以通过阅读相关书籍、在线教程或参加培训班来学习vba语言的语法、数据类型、变量和运算符等基础知识。
3.2 多练习
在学习任何一门技术都需要多加练习,vba编程也不例外。通过不断地练习编写代码,可以更加熟悉语法并提高编程能力。同时,也可以通过阅读别人的代码来学习他们的思路和技巧。
3.3 实践应用
最有效的学习方式就是将所学应用到实践中。在日常工作中遇到重复性操作或需要大量处理数据的情况时,尝试用vba编程来解决问题。这样不仅可以提高工作效率,也能够巩固所学知识
学习vba编程前需要具备的基础知识
1. 了解基本的编程概念
在学习VBA编程之前,有必要先了解一些基本的编程概念,例如变量、数据类型、循环和条件语句等。这些概念是编程的基础,掌握它们能够帮助你更快地理解VBA语言。
2. 掌握Excel基础知识
VBA是一种在Excel中使用的编程语言,因此在学习VBA之前,你需要具备一定的Excel基础知识。比如如何创建和编辑工作表、使用函数和公式等。这些知识将为你后续学习VBA打下坚实的基础。
3. 熟悉VBA开发环境
在开始学习VBA编程之前,建议先熟悉一下VBA开发环境。它包括代码窗口、项目资源管理器和属性窗口等。了解这些工具能够帮助你更有效地编写和调试代码。
4. 学习Visual Basic语言
VBA是建立在Visual Basic语言之上的,因此学习Visual Basic语言也是学习VBA的重要步骤。Visual Basic是一种面向对象的编程语言,掌握它能够帮助你更好地理解VBA。
5. 具备良好的逻辑思维能力
编程需要具备良好的逻辑思维能力,这意味着你需要能够将复杂的问题分解为简单的步骤,并能够按照一定的顺序来解决它们。如果你具备良好的逻辑思维能力,学习VBA会更加轻松。
6. 有耐心和持久性
学习任何一种编程语言都需要耐心和持久性,VBA也不例外。有时候会遇到一些难以理解的问题或者出现错误,但是只要保持耐心并且持续不断地学习,最终你一定会掌握VBA编程。
7. 多实践多练习
学习VBA编程前需要具备一些基础知识,包括了解基本的编程概念、掌握Excel基础知识、熟悉VBA开发环境、学习Visual Basic语言、具备良好的逻辑思维能力、有耐心和持久性以及多实践多练习。掌握这些基础知识能够帮助你更快地学习VBA,并且在实际应用中能够更加游刃有余
如何快速入门vba编程?推荐的学习方法和资源
学习vba编程可能对很多人来说是一件挑战性的任务,但是它却是非常有用的技能,在教育培训行业也越来越受欢迎。那么,如何快速入门vba编程呢?下面我将为大家介绍一些学习方法和资源,帮助你快速掌握vba编程基础知识。
1. 充分了解vba编程的用途
在开始学习vba编程之前,首先要了解它的用途。vba是一种宏语言,可以帮助用户自动执行重复性的任务,提高工作效率。它在Excel、Word、PowerPoint等微软办公软件中都有广泛应用,可以帮助用户完成各种复杂的操作。因此,在学习vba编程之前,要明确自己想要实现什么样的功能,这样可以更有针对性地学习。
2. 学习基础知识
掌握任何一门技能都需要从基础知识开始。对于vba编程来说,最重要的就是了解其基本语法和常用函数。这些内容可以通过查阅相关书籍或在线教程来学习。同时,也可以通过观看视频教程来更直观地学习。建议可以从简单的例子开始练习,逐步加深理解。
3. 使用宏录制功能
对于初学者来说,最好的学习方法就是通过宏录制功能来学习。宏录制可以帮助用户记录下自己的操作步骤,并生成相应的vba代码。通过观察这些代码,可以更直观地了解vba编程的运行逻辑,从而加深理解。
4. 多练习
熟能生巧,在学习任何一门技能时都需要不断地练习。对于vba编程来说也是如此,只有不断地练习才能掌握其基础知识和运用技巧。建议可以通过做一些实际的小项目来提升自己的编程能力。
5. 寻找优质资源
在学习vba编程过程中,寻找优质资源也是非常重要的。除了书籍、在线教程和视频教程外,还可以加入一些vba编程交流群或论坛,与其他人交流经验和问题。同时也可以关注一些专业网站或博客,了解最新的vba编程技巧和资源
vba编程常用语法和函数介绍
1. 什么是vba编程?
VBA(Visual Basic for Applications)是一种广泛应用于Microsoft Office软件中的编程语言,它可以帮助用户自定义和控制Office应用程序的功能。通过使用VBA,用户可以编写自己的宏程序和自定义函数,从而实现更高效、更精确的操作。
2. vba编程常用语法
(1) 变量声明:在使用变量之前,需要先声明变量的类型。例如:Dim a As Integer,表示声明一个整型变量a。
(2) 循环结构:vba提供了多种循环结构来帮助用户重复执行某些操作。常用的有For循环、Do While循环和Do Until循环。
(3) 条件语句:条件语句可以根据条件来决定是否执行某些操作。常用的有If…Then语句和Select Case语句。
(4) 函数和子程序:函数是一段可重复使用的代码,而子程序是一段可重复使用且不返回值的代码。通过编写函数和子程序,可以使代码更加模块化、易于维护。
(5) 错误处理:在编写代码时,难免会出现错误。vba提供了多种错误处理机制来帮助用户处理这些错误。
3. vba常用函数介绍
(1) 字符串函数:vba提供了多种字符串处理函数,例如Left、Right、Mid等函数用于截取字符串;Len函数用于返回字符串的长度。
(2) 数学函数:vba提供了一些常用的数学函数,例如Abs、Sqrt、Round等函数,可以帮助用户进行数值计算。
(3) 日期和时间函数:vba提供了多种日期和时间处理函数,例如Date、Time、Month等函数,可以帮助用户处理日期和时间数据。
(4) 数据转换函数:vba提供了一些数据转换函数,例如CInt、CDbl、CStr等函数,可以将数据类型转换为其他类型。
(5) Excel对象方法:在使用vba编程时,经常需要操作Excel表格中的数据。vba提供了多种Excel对象方法来帮助用户实现这些操作。
4. 如何快速掌握vba编程基础知识?
(1) 学习基础语法:首先要掌握vba的基本语法和常用的语句结构。可以通过阅读相关书籍或参加培训课程来学习。
(2) 练习编写代码:只有不断地练习才能熟练掌握vba编程。可以选择一些简单的任务来练习编写代码,并逐步增加难度。
(3) 查阅文档:在遇到问题时,可以查阅官方文档或搜索相关资料来解决。同时也可以通过阅读他人的代码来学习优秀的编程技巧。
(4) 参考示例:在Excel软件中,可以通过点击“开发工具”选项卡中的“宏”按钮,选择“编辑”来查看宏代码。这些示例代码可以帮助用户学习vba编程的实际应用。
(5) 坚持练习:vba编程需要不断地练习和积累,只有坚持不懈地学习和使用,才能快速掌握基础知识并提高自己的编程能力。
vba编程是一项非常有用的技能,在教育培训行业也有着广泛的应用。通过学习vba编程常用语法和函数介绍,可以帮助用户快速掌握基础知识,并通过不断练习和实践来提高自己的编程能力。同时,也要注意避免使用超链接等违反原创内容要求的行为,保证内容精准详细
如何运用vba编程提高工作效率?实用案例分享
1. 了解vba编程的基础知识
要想运用vba编程提高工作效率,首先需要掌握vba编程的基础知识。vba是一种宏语言,可以在微软office软件中进行编程,如excel、word等。因此,熟悉office软件的使用和基本操作是必不可少的。
2. 学习基本的vba语法和常用函数
在掌握office软件的基本操作后,就可以开始学习vba的语法和常用函数了。vba语法与其他编程语言相似,例如变量、循环、条件判断等。同时,掌握常用函数能够提高代码的效率和可读性。
3. 尝试简单实用案例
学习理论知识固然重要,但更重要的是实践。通过尝试一些简单实用的案例来巩固所学知识,并且能够更好地理解和掌握vba编程。
4. 利用录制宏功能快速生成代码
除了手动编写代码外,office软件还提供了录制宏功能。通过录制宏可以快速生成一些简单的代码,节省时间和精力。
5. 学习高级技巧提升工作效率
除了掌握基础知识外,还可以学习一些高级技巧来提升工作效率。例如利用vba编写自动化报表、数据处理等功能,能够大大减少重复性工作,提高工作效率。
6. 实践案例分享
为了更好地帮助大家理解如何运用vba编程提高工作效率,接下来将分享一个实际案例。某公司需要每天生成一份销售报表,包含各部门的销售额和利润情况。通过利用vba编程,可以实现自动抓取数据并生成报表的功能,大大节省了手动整理数据的时间和精力
相信大家已经了解了vba编程的基础知识和学习方法,也知道如何运用vba编程提高工作效率。vba编程是一门非常实用的技能,掌握它可以让我们在工作中事半功倍。作为网站的编辑,我也是一位热爱学习和分享的人,希望能够帮助更多人掌握这门技能。如果你对vba编程感兴趣,请关注我,我们一起学习进步吧!